Christine was a senior civil servant in the Scottish Government, leading in various policy areas, including Education and the Third Sector. She spent 8 years in the Scottish Prison Service, with Board roles as Director of HR and Director Estates. She led several £multi-million procurements, including the first PFI prison in Scotland. Having joined the Third Sector in 2015, Christine has worked at senior level in both UK and Scottish charities – she was the first Chief Executive of a charity supporting families whose children have learning difficulties. Her current role is Director Scotland, Home-Start, a UK charity supporting families with young children.
Christine is also a member of Changing the Chemistry (CtC) a peer-led charity focused on improving diversity of thought in the boardroom, where she is part of the Strategic Communications team.
